Summary

Anthropic acquired Stainless, the company behind API SDK generation and developer tooling used to turn specs into production client libraries and MCP servers. The deal pulls more of the agent developer stack inside Anthropic's platform strategy.

What changed

Anthropic announced the acquisition of Stainless and said the team and product will continue operating while supporting Anthropic's developer platform work.

Why it matters

This is a platform-depth move, not just a talent acquisition. Owning SDK generation and protocol tooling helps Anthropic shape how developers integrate models, tools, and MCP services, which can tighten ecosystem control around Claude-based agent workflows.

Evidence excerpt

Anthropic says it is acquiring Stainless, whose tooling turns OpenAPI specs into SDKs and MCP servers, to help developers build more reliably on its platform.
